INDIA REALTY EXCELLENCE FUND II India Realty Excellence Fund II Investment Objectives:- * IREF II will focus on Mezzanine transactions with developers having proven track record. * B9Focus on top 5 cities viz., MMR, NCR, Bangalore, Puneand Chennai. * Investments will endeavordownside protection and threshold return in the range of 13% to 18% through agreed/ preferred return with an upside kicker taking the overall IRR to 25%+. *Upside kicker linked to an identified inventory / top line sharing, to delink the upside from project profitability. Key Fund Terms:- Particulars Description Fund Size INR 300 crorewith Green-shoe option of up to INR 200 crore Eligible Investor Individuals, Company, Banks, Financial Institutions & Category II AIF which is formed as a LLP, company or a body corporate Sponsor & Affiliates Commitment 20% of the Fund corpus subject to minimum of INR 50 crore Managing Partner Motilal Oswal Real Estate Investment Advisors Private Limited Tenure of the Fund 4 years (extendable by 1 + 1 years) Commitment Period 2 years (extendable by 1 year) Minimum Commitment Institutional Investors - INR 5 (five) crore Other Investors -INR 1 (one) crore Initial Contribution with Application 20% of commitment amount Hurdle Rate 14% p.a. (pre- tax)* Fund Structure Limited Liability Partnership, registered with SEBI as category II Alternate Investment Fund 16
